What is Project Management?
Definition and Core Principles
Project management is the application of knowledge, skills, tools, and techniques to project activities to meet the project requirements. It involves initiating, planning, executing, monitoring, controlling, and closing a project. The core principles include:
- Planning: Defining the project’s objectives, scope, and resources.
- Execution: Carrying out the tasks and activities outlined in the project plan.
- Monitoring and Controlling: Tracking progress, managing risks, and making necessary adjustments.
- Closure: Formalizing project completion and documenting lessons learned.
For example, consider a software development project. The planning phase involves defining the features, setting a timeline, and allocating resources. Execution involves coding, testing, and integrating the software. Monitoring and controlling include tracking progress against the timeline and managing any bugs or issues. Finally, closure involves delivering the software to the client and documenting the development process.

Key Project Management Processes
Initiation
The initiation phase involves defining the project’s purpose, objectives, and scope. This phase typically includes:
- Developing a Project Charter: A formal document that authorizes the project and defines its scope, objectives, and stakeholders.
- Conducting a Feasibility Study: Assessing the project’s viability and potential benefits.
- Identifying Stakeholders: Determining who will be affected by the project and their interests.
For instance, if a company wants to launch a new marketing campaign, the initiation phase would involve defining the target audience, setting the campaign’s goals (e.g., increasing brand awareness, generating leads), and identifying key stakeholders (e.g., marketing team, sales team, management).
Planning
The planning phase involves creating a detailed roadmap for executing the project. Key activities include:
- Defining the Project Scope: Clearly outlining what is included and excluded from the project.
- Creating a Work Breakdown Structure (WBS): Breaking down the project into smaller, manageable tasks.
- Developing a Project Schedule: Estimating the time required for each task and creating a timeline.
- Allocating Resources: Assigning resources (e.g., personnel, equipment, budget) to each task.
- Risk Management Planning: Identifying potential risks and developing mitigation strategies.
Example: if the project is building a house, the WBS would break it down into tasks like foundation, framing, roofing, plumbing, electrical, and interior finishing. Each task would have a schedule and assigned resources.
Execution
The execution phase involves carrying out the tasks and activities outlined in the project plan. This includes:
- Directing and Managing Project Work: Coordinating and overseeing the project team.
- Performing Quality Assurance: Ensuring that deliverables meet the required standards.
- Managing Communications: Keeping stakeholders informed about project progress.
- Managing Changes: Addressing and documenting any changes to the project plan.
In a construction project, execution involves the actual building process, ensuring that the work is done according to the plans and specifications. Regular quality checks are performed to identify and fix any issues. Communication with stakeholders, such as the client and subcontractors, is crucial to keep everyone informed.
Monitoring and Controlling
The monitoring and controlling phase involves tracking project progress, managing risks, and making necessary adjustments. Key activities include:
- Monitoring Project Performance: Tracking progress against the project schedule and budget.
- Managing Risks: Identifying and mitigating potential problems.
- Controlling Changes: Ensuring that changes are properly documented and approved.
- Reporting Performance: Providing regular updates to stakeholders on project progress.
For example, if a project is behind schedule, the project manager would analyze the reasons for the delay and take corrective actions, such as reallocating resources or adjusting the timeline. Regular reports are provided to stakeholders to keep them informed of the project’s status.
Closure
The closure phase involves formalizing project completion and documenting lessons learned. This includes:
- Finalizing Project Deliverables: Ensuring that all deliverables are complete and accepted by the client.
- Conducting a Project Review: Assessing the project’s success and identifying areas for improvement.
- Documenting Lessons Learned: Capturing insights and best practices for future projects.
- Releasing Resources: Reassigning project team members and closing out contracts.
When a software project is complete, the closure phase involves delivering the final software to the client, obtaining formal acceptance, conducting a project review to identify what went well and what could be improved, and documenting these lessons learned for future projects. The project team is then disbanded and reassigned to other projects.
Essential Project Management Tools and Techniques
Project Management Software
Various software tools can help manage projects effectively, including:
- Asana: A popular project management tool for task management, collaboration, and reporting.
- Trello: A visual project management tool using Kanban boards to organize tasks and workflows.
- Jira: A project management tool commonly used in software development for tracking bugs and issues.
- Microsoft Project: A comprehensive project management tool for planning, scheduling, and resource management.
- Monday.com: A work operating system that helps teams manage projects, workflows, and daily tasks.
The choice of software depends on the project’s complexity, team size, and specific requirements. For example, a small team managing a simple project might find Trello sufficient, while a large team managing a complex project might need the more advanced features of Microsoft Project or Asana.
Project Management Methodologies
Different project management methodologies offer frameworks for managing projects, including:
- Waterfall: A sequential, linear approach where each phase must be completed before moving on to the next.
- Agile: An iterative and flexible approach that emphasizes collaboration and continuous improvement.
- Scrum: A specific Agile framework that uses short iterations called sprints to deliver incremental value.
- Kanban: A visual workflow management method that focuses on limiting work in progress and improving flow.
- Prince2: A structured project management method that provides a framework of processes and themes.
For example, a construction project might use the Waterfall methodology due to its structured and predictable nature. In contrast, a software development project might benefit from the Agile methodology due to its flexibility and ability to adapt to changing requirements.
Risk Management
Effective risk management involves identifying, assessing, and mitigating potential risks. This includes:
- Risk Identification: Identifying potential risks that could impact the project.
- Risk Assessment: Evaluating the likelihood and impact of each risk.
- Risk Response Planning: Developing strategies to mitigate or avoid risks.
- Risk Monitoring and Control: Tracking risks and implementing mitigation plans.
For instance, in a construction project, risks might include weather delays, material shortages, or safety hazards. The project manager would assess the likelihood and impact of each risk and develop mitigation plans, such as securing alternative suppliers or implementing safety training programs.
Best Practices for Successful Project Management
Communication
Effective communication is crucial for keeping stakeholders informed and aligned. Best practices include:
- Establishing a Communication Plan: Defining how, when, and with whom to communicate.
- Holding Regular Status Meetings: Providing updates on project progress and addressing any issues.
- Using Collaboration Tools: Facilitating communication and collaboration among team members.
- Being Transparent and Open: Sharing information openly and honestly with stakeholders.
Example: a project manager might establish a communication plan that includes weekly status meetings, daily stand-up meetings for the project team, and regular email updates to stakeholders. The use of collaboration tools, such as Slack or Microsoft Teams, can facilitate communication and collaboration among team members.
Leadership and Teamwork
Strong leadership and effective teamwork are essential for project success. Best practices include:
- Providing Clear Direction: Setting clear goals and expectations for the project team.
- Empowering Team Members: Giving team members the autonomy to make decisions and take ownership of their work.
- Fostering a Collaborative Environment: Encouraging teamwork, communication, and mutual support.
- Recognizing and Rewarding Success: Acknowledging and celebrating team accomplishments.
A good project manager provides clear direction by setting SMART (Specific, Measurable, Achievable, Relevant, Time-bound) goals for the project team. They empower team members by giving them the autonomy to make decisions within their areas of expertise and foster a collaborative environment by encouraging teamwork and open communication.
Continuous Improvement
Continuously evaluating and improving project management processes is crucial for long-term success. Best practices include:
- Conducting Post-Project Reviews: Assessing what went well and what could be improved.
- Documenting Lessons Learned: Capturing insights and best practices for future projects.
- Implementing Process Improvements: Making changes to improve project management processes.
- Staying Updated on Industry Trends: Keeping abreast of new tools, techniques, and methodologies.
After each project, conduct a post-project review to assess what went well and what could be improved. Document these lessons learned and implement process improvements to enhance future project management practices. Staying updated on industry trends ensures that you are using the latest tools and techniques to manage projects effectively.
